How Did the NCA Uncover LockBit Gang Leader’s Identity?

The UK’s National Crime Agency (NCA) achieved a watershed moment in cybersecurity when it successfully disclosed the identity of the leader behind the notorious LockBit ransomware gang, which had been terrorizing organizations globally. Through a series of sophisticated investigative techniques and international collaborations, the NCA’s breakthrough marked significant milestones in the ongoing battle against cybercrime.

Penetrating the Digital Fortress

What stood between the law enforcement agencies and the LockBit gang was a series of sophisticated encryption protocols and clandestine communication channels. The NCA’s first critical move was to infiltrate these channels, which required a combination of cyber intelligence and traditional gumshoe methodology. By dissecting the digital footprints left by the gang, analysts were able to piece together the silhouetted identity of their leader.

The journey of unmasking Dmitry Khoroshev, also known as “LockBitSupp”, was no easy task. It involved tracking monetary transactions, collating gathered intelligence with global databases, and exploiting the occasional operational slip by the threat actors themselves. Relying heavily on data analytics, the NCA, along with its international partners, meticulously mapped out the network of LockBit, which led them closer to the core of their leadership structure. Indeed, it was the consistency in Khoroshev’s digital signature across various platforms that ultimately betrayed his anonymity.
